Clinical Trials Forum: World AIDS Day (December 1), BostonOctober 31, 2003 On World AIDS Day (December 1, 2003) Search for a Cure will hold
a free community forum on clinical trials for persons with HIV -- including information on hepatitis and other co-infections,
nutrition, microbicides, and other related topics. People can
speak with researchers running the trials and with volunteers
currently in studies, at information tables for many trials now
open in New England. Experts will discuss what to consider when
thinking about volunteering for a trial. Search for a Cure will
distribute a manual on major HIV clinical trials in New England,
and how to find out about trials elsewhere. A free dinner is
included in this program.
Many AIDS trials are being seriously delayed because not enough patients enroll. Search for a Cure hopes to help increase enrollment when possible. Other organizations may want to try similar programs in their cities.
